Safety device and method to prevent use of the same device if faulty
11557905 · 2023-01-17 · ·

The present invention discloses a safety devices adapted to prevent workers from going into hazardous environment, such as underground using the faulty safety device. As a safety device, typically embodied as a cap lamp, must be charged prior to each use, the device is adapted to detect when the device is removed from the charger. The device starts to blink continuously when disconnected from the charger. An automated test procedure is completed on the device. The user may also complete a manual portion of the test procedure to make the device usable. When the test procedure is completed successfully, the lamp stops blinking. If the test procedure is not successful, the lamp continues blinking to effectively prevent user from using a faulty device.

Charging Management and Control Method and Electronic Device

This application discloses a charging management and control method and an electronic device. The method includes: When connecting to an external power supply, the electronic device starts to obtain data such as a time at which the external power supply is connected, a battery level, and a charger type; the electronic device obtains first duration and second duration based on the data; in the first duration, the electronic device performs fast charging on the battery; and in the second duration, the electronic device performs slow charging on the battery, or suspends charging the battery. In this way, the electronic device performs management and control on a charging process of the battery when charging the battery, to reduce a time of continuing charging the battery in a fully charged state by the electronic device.

INTEGRATED MONITORING CAPACITY OF A POWER BANK BATTERY AND DEVICES CHARGED THEREWITH

A portable power bank including a rechargeable battery and/or a remote server may detect loss of capacity in the power bank battery. The power bank and/or remote server determines a nominal capacity of the power bank, and an actual capacity of the power bank, the actual capacity being less than the nominal capacity. The power bank and/or remote server compares the actual capacity to the nominal capacity to determine a health value of the power bank battery. When the power bank battery health value is at or below a threshold value, the power bank and/or remote server transmits an indication of the health value.
